Crocus mathewii is a small perennial flowering plant native to southwestern Turkey. It grows to a height of 5-7 cm and has linear, grass-like leaves. The flowers are white with a yellow center and bloom in late winter and early spring. It belongs to the genus Crocus of the family Iridaceae and is a cormous plant.
